一种基站多用户广播发送数据的方法技术

技术编号:10614450 阅读:235 留言:0更新日期:2014-11-06 10:15
本发明专利技术公开了一种基站多用户广播发送数据的方法,该方法使用多个移动用户对应的最差信道y1和已经积累的下载请求总数量y2作为评判标准,考虑用函数F(x)=αx,x≥0描述的传输时间延迟、每个传输时隙的长度τ、请求下载的信息的传输速率C、每个时隙到达的请求数量均值λ、第一个请求到达后等待空闲信道所花的时间T、以及能量效率和时延的平衡因子w≥0,其中α是正常数,x为等待的时隙数量,确定如下的两个基站传输信息准则:1.当且或者2.当且本发明专利技术针对3G、4G等蜂窝移动通信系统下行链路中存在的大量相同的数据通信业务,通过引入一定的传输时延,能大幅度提高基站多用户广播的能量效率,同时充分利用信道带宽资源。

【技术实现步骤摘要】
一种基站多用户广播发送数据的方法
本专利技术涉及电子通讯
,特别是一种基站多用户广播发送数据的方法。
技术介绍
在当前的3G,4G,4G-LTE系统中,存在大量的数据业务(例如,移动用户下载新闻、音乐和视频)。该业务的特点是:其主要集中在蜂窝移动通信系统的下行链路中(即上下行链路业务量强非对称性);各个不同的移动用户可能下载完全相同的数据(业务强相似性)。这两个方面是数据业务区别于传统的语音业务最大特点。基于此,如果仍然在新一代通信系统中采取“用户请求-基站响应”的一对一服务模式,可以预见:由于基站大量重复发射完全相同的信息,小区的系统资源(包括信道和基站发射能量)被大量相同的请求所占用和消耗,从而整个系统处于较低效率的运行状态。对上面提到的数据业务中面临的新挑战,一个很简单易行的解决办法是把该相同的数据信息在同一信道和同一时刻内,通过多用户广播(multicasting)技术发送给多个移动用户。通过这样做,可以极大的提高系统的能量利用效率:即单位能量可以满足更多的用户请求。但另一方面,在实际系统中,移动用户的下载请求是随机发生的;如果要在同一时刻服务多个不同时刻的请求,先到达的请求必然会被延迟一段时间再服务,从而给部分用户请求引入额外的时延。从上面的分析可以得知,多用户广播中存在时延和能量效率的折中。现有的关于多用户广播调度算法,都没有考虑下载请求随机到达引起的用户时延问题。在本专利技术中,同时考虑请求的时延以及基站能量效率,定义为每个请求的平均消耗能量,这两个待优化的目标,并设计一个简单、高效、普适的多用户广播调度算法。
技术实现思路
本专利技术的目的在于克服现有技术的不足,提供一种简单、高效、适应力强,通过引入一定的时延,能大幅度提高基站多用户广播的能量效率,同时节约信道带宽的一种基站多用户广播发送数据的方法。本专利技术的目的是通过以下技术方案来实现的:一种基站多用户广播发送数据的方法,通过引入一定的时延,提高基站多用户广播的能量效率,节约信道带宽,它包括以下步骤:S0:初始化系统参数:下载信息的传输速率为C;τ为每个传输时隙的长度;用函数F(x)=αx,x≥0计算下载请求的时延,其中α是正常数;定义常数w≥0作为时延的权重;S1:初始化定时器,即将上一次基站开始发送数据之后第一个新的请求到达的时间作为第一时刻;S2:启动计时器,继续接收新的用户数据下载请求;记从第一时刻开始到有一个空闲信道的时间为T;S3:在当前时刻S,计算请求来源的移动用户的最差的信道为y1,定义其中第t-1时隙内到达的下载请求数量为Rt,其均值为E(Rt)=λ,为每个请求来源的移动用户对应的信道,1≤it≤Rt,满足到第S-1时隙为止所积累的下载请求总数量为y2,则:(1)当并且则立即发送信息;(2)当并且则立即发送信息;S4:重复步骤S1~S3。所述的信息为多个用户向基站请求下载的同一个数据文件;数据文件的长度为任意时隙长度;基站端可用的信道数量为任意数量。本专利技术的有益效果是:本专利技术针对3G、4G蜂窝移动通信系统下行链路中存在的大量相同的数据通信业务,通过引入一定的时延,能大幅度提高基站多用户广播的能量效率,同时节约信道带宽,特别针对随机到达的下载相同数据的用户请求,确定基站何时发送相同的该信息,而不满足条件时基站则保持静默等待更多的用户请求到达。附图说明图1为不同下载请求到达速率下本申请算法与最优算法比较图。具体实施方式下面结合附图进一步详细描述本专利技术的技术方案,但本专利技术的保护范围不局限于以下所述。一种基站多用户广播发送数据的方法,通过引入一定的时延,提高基站多用户广播的能量效率,节约信道带宽,它包括以下步骤:S0:初始化系统参数:下载信息的传输速率为C;τ为每个传输时隙的长度;用函数F(x)=αx,x≥0计算下载请求的时延,其中α是正常数;定义常数w≥0作为时延的权重;S1:初始化定时器,即将上一次基站开始发送数据之后第一个新的请求到达的时间作为第一时刻;S2:启动计时器,继续接收新的用户数据下载请求;记从第一时刻开始到有一个空闲信道的时间为T;S3:在当前时刻S,计算请求来源的移动用户的最差的信道为y1,定义其中第t-1时隙内到达的下载请求数量为Rt,其均值为E(Rt)=λ,为每个请求来源的移动用户对应的信道,1≤it≤Rt,满足到第S-1时隙为止所积累的下载请求总数量为y2,则:(1)当并且则立即发送信息;(2)当并且则立即发送信息;S4:重复步骤S1~S3。所述的信息为多个用户向基站请求下载的同一个数据文件;数据文件的长度为任意时隙长度;基站端可用的信道数量为任意数量。如图1所示,比较了本申请的算法,与最优的算法,在不同的下载请求到达速率E(Rt)=0.5,1,2,4个请求每个时隙的情况下,所能达到的平均时延F(x)=αx,x≥0与能量效率之间的折中关系,系数w取不同数值,从而可以达到曲线上的任何一点,其中下载请求到达速率=请求数量/传输时隙。从该图可以看出,本申请中的算法,可以在不同参数情况下,达到近似最优的性能,图中本申请的算法表示为suboptimalscheme,最优算法表示为optimalstoppingtheory。同时,可以看出:当引入哪怕很小的平均时延,基站服务单个求情消耗的平均能量都能极大的降低。比如,当E(Rt)=0.5时,平均时延为1个时隙时,相对与传统的“用户请求-基站响应”方式,即不允许时延方式时,基站能节约0.4/1.4=28.6%的发射能量。另外,值得指出的是,本申请中的算法,只需要知道最差信道的数值和下载请求的平均到达速率;而最优算法需要知道这两个随机变量的分布信息,这在实际系统中很难准确估计到,因而本申请的算法比最优算法更易实现。本文档来自技高网...

【技术保护点】
一种基站多用户广播发送数据的方法,通过引入一定的时延,提高基站多用户广播的能量效率,节约信道带宽,其特征在于:它包括以下步骤:S0:初始化系统参数:下载信息的传输速率为C;τ为每个传输时隙的长度;用函数F(x)=αx,x≥0计算下载请求的时延,其中α是正常数;定义常数w≥0作为时延的权重;S1:初始化定时器,即将上一次基站开始发送数据之后第一个新的请求到达的时间作为第一时刻;S2:启动计时器,继续接收新的用户数据下载请求;记从第一时刻开始到有一个空闲信道的时间为T;S3:在当前时刻S,计算请求来源的移动用户的最差的信道为y1,定义其中第t‑1时隙内到达的下载请求数量为Rt,其均值为E(Rt)=λ,为每个请求来源的移动用户对应的信道,1≤it≤Rt,满足到第S‑1时隙为止所积累的下载请求总数量为y2,则:(1)当y2>(2c-1)τ(T+1)awα-λ2,]]>并且y1≤wα(2c-1)τy2,]]>则立即发送信息;(2)当y2≤(2c-1)τ(T+1)awα-λ2,]]>并且y1≤1a-(0.5+(2c-1)τaλwα(T+1)-y2λ)2wαλ2(2c-1)τ,]]>则立即发送信息;S4:重复步骤S1~S3。...

【技术特征摘要】
1.一种基站多用户广播发送数据的方法,通过引入一定的时延,提高基站多用户广播的能量效率,节约信道带宽,其特征在于:它包括以下步骤:S0:初始化系统参数:下载信息的传输速率为C;τ为每个传输时隙的长度;用函数F(x)=αx,x≥0计算下载请求的时延,其中α是正常数;定义常数w≥0作为时延的权重;S1:初始化定时器,即将上一次基站开始发送数据之后第一个新的请求到达的时间作为第一时刻;S2:启动计时器,继续接收新的用户数据下载请求;记从第一时刻开始到有一个空闲信道的时间为T;S3:在当前时刻S,计算请求来源的移动用...

【专利技术属性】
技术研发人员:黄川唐友喜邵士海
申请(专利权)人:电子科技大学
类型:发明
国别省市:四川;51

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1